Let's take a closer look at the four primary roles in social anxiety advocacy in the UK, as represented by the 3D pie chart. 1. **Psychologists (60%)**
These professionals diagnose and treat social anxiety disorder through c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), exposure therapy, or medication. A Psychology degree and postgraduate training are essential. 2. **Counselors (25%)**
Counselors offer guidance and support by providing clients with coping strategies, teaching communication skills, and helping them build self-esteem. A degree in counseling and relevant certifications are necessary. 3. **Social Workers (10%)**
Social workers address the broader social and environmental factors affecting individuals with social anxiety. A degree in social work and registration with the relevant professional body are required. 4. **Special Education Teachers (SPED Teachers, 5%)**
SPED teachers work with students with social anxiety in an educational setting. A teaching degree and specialized training in special education are required for this role.
